Testimonials

An Islamic Imam

An Islamic Imam, after studying WEI lessons, wrote, “It is very fantastic for me to know about the real Christian opinions. I’m Muslim. I have studied about six years at Islamic schools and became an Islamic imam. I thought that Christians have three Gods, but now I find that they have only one God, and they have many other beautiful and respectable opinions.”

October 4, 2013
David Binkley

David Binkley, missionary to Russia and Ukraine, writes, “We are still amazed at how many friends and prospects we have established here in Nikolaev that are connected with the English language. Dick Ady agreed for us to use the WEI materials in our efforts.”

Doyle Kee

Doyle Kee, missionary in Switzerland, writes, “One of the most impressive evangelistic tools around the world . . . is World English Institute (WEI).”

Don Wright

Don Wright, former missionary, writes, “It is my opinion, after a lifetime of teaching in four countries (Vietnam, Ireland, Russia, and China) that WEI is the most effective method available, both for individual and group teaching.”

Perry Taylor

Perry Taylor, a WEI teacher who worships with the Cloverdale congregation in Florence, AL, writes, “World English Institute is one of the greatest tools the church has to reach the world—especially the Muslim world.”

Aniefiok Akpan

Aniefiok Akpan, national preacher in Nigeria, writes, “When God placed WEI materials as an evangelistic tool in our hands several years ago, we never knew to what extent we would go in reaching out to souls with these resources. Today, many persons have had the opportunity to hear the gospel through World English Institute as preachers from different regions of Nigeria embrace the ministry. Outside Nigeria, gospel preachers in Cameroon, Ghana, Sierra Leone, Gambia, Senegal, and other countries of Africa are using WEI materials in their evangelistic outreach. Presently, I have the grace to serve as the chaplain and campus minister in Obong University, the first private university associated with churches of Christ in Africa. Many students of the university have enrolled in the WEI programme.”

A Note from the Laurel Elders

“The Laurel congregation truly appreciates what WEI has done in the past, and we look forward to what will happen in the future as we work together to spread the gospel in such a unique way. We are grateful that our congregation financially supports WEI and that more of our members are signing up as WEI teachers. I am especially thankful that many college students in Knoxville are signing up as WEI teachers. It is exciting to see how our young Christians are making an impact for Christ in China and throughout the world.”

Editorial Comment: We praise God for leading us to Justin and Lisa Acuff and to the Laurel Church of Christ. The future of WEI just got brighter.
